dri1002 - ikt og informasjonssøking forelesning uke 17 og 18
Post on 17-Jan-2016
38 Views
Preview:
DESCRIPTION
TRANSCRIPT
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
DRI1002 - IKT og informasjonssøking Forelesning uke 17 og 18
Hovedpunktene i forelesningen • Litt om generelt om lagdeling og
standardisering • Litt repetisjon om Internett fysisk og logisk
struktur • Litt om WWW-teknologi og standardisering
• Organisering og styring av WWW: W3C
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
Hovedpunkter 1. forelesning
• Internett – Logisk, teknisk, organisatorisk og juridiske
perspektiver - Arkitektur : lag og protokoller
• Hannemyr, Gisle. Nettverksarkitektur. Artikkel til kurset IN-INT. http://www.ifi.uio.no/inint/emne04a.html
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
Internettet - ulike perspektiver
– Fysisk – teknisk utstrekning:• En (ubegrenset) samling av datanettverk som er knyttet
sammen og kan kommunisere med hverandre
– Logisk arkitektur• Basert på et sett av felles prosedyrer og formater for
kommunikasjon (protokoller), inkludert lagdeling og adresseringsregime mm :
– Organisatorisk og juridisk rammeverk :• Internasjonale, nasjonale og lokale organisasjoner som
samarbeider i henhold til felles overenskomster og retningslinjer for utvikling og drift/administrasjon, f eks endring av protokoller, tildeling av domenenavn, adresser, rettigheter mm
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
Ulike lag i en datakommunikasjonsmodell- forenkelt
Bruker-orienterte anvendelser (applikasjoner)
Bruker-orienterte anvendelser (applikasjoner)
Ende-til-ende utveksling av data, feilkontroll mm
Ende-til-ende utveksling av data, feilkontroll mm
Adressering og ruting
Adressering og ruting
Kontroll av linjer/forbindelser
Kontroll av linjer/forbindelser
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
Internet: Arkitektur og protokoller
En forenklet 4-lags versjon av OSI-modellen:• Lag 5-7: SMTP, FTP, WWW (HTTP&HTML),... • Lag 4: TCP (Transmission Control Protocol) • Lag 3 : IP (Internet Protocol ) • Lag 1-2 : ’Det meste går’ : ISDN, xDSL,
lokalnett, GSM/GPRS/UMTS, ......
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
Datamaskinen som sorte bokser
PC med Windows
E_post, Nett-lesere, Chat, ..
PC med Linux
E_post, Nett-lesere, Chat, ..
’PC’ med Mac
I ntosh
E_post, Nett-lesere, Chat, ..
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
Datamaskinen som en løk:Lagdeling og modularisering
Kjernen: maskinvarer
Basis OS : Filsystem, basis programvarer
E_post, Nett-lesere, Chat, ..
Anvenderprogrammer og systemer: Nettsteder, vev-tjenster, portaler
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
Datamaskinen som en løk:Lagdeling og modularisering
Bruker-orienterte anvendelser (applikasjoner)
Ende-til-ende utveksling av data, f eilkontroll med mer
Adressering og ruting
Kontroll av linjer/ f orbindelser
…..
Kjernen: maskinvarer
Basis OS : Filsystem, basis programvarer
E_post, Nett-lesere, Chat, ..
Anvenderprogrammer og systemer: Nettsteder, vev-
tjenester, portaler
Søkemotorer…
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
Logisk Network arkitekture The OSI model
.
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
Standardisering på Internett
To grunnleggende ulike måter å standardisere på
• Topp-styrt - diktatorisk – Eks. Telefonnettet, windows, ..
• Nedenfra – mer demokratisk gjennom eksperimentering – Eks. Internett, Linux,..
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
Noen aktuelle standarder på Internet
• Lag 1-2 : mange standarder • Lag 3-4 : IP/TCP (+ noen andre) • Lag 5-6 : SMTP, FTP med flere WWW har blant annet disse protokoller
HTTP: Hyper Text Transfer protocol HTML: Hyper Text Markup Language
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
Det organisatoriske perspektivet: Hvem ’styrer’ Internett
• Internet Engineering Taks force (IETF 1986) – Ser på tekniske spørsmål og problemer– Portokoller for kortsiktige løsninger – Åpen samfunn – ’alle’ kan delta
• Andre organisasjoner er IEST, IERT, IAB • WWW Consortium : W3C
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
World Wide Web (W3C) 1994
– 437 medlemsorganisasjoner – W3C Team 73 personer. Ledes av Tim Berners-Lee
Mål og prinsipper 1. Universell tilgjengelighet2. Semantisk vev3. Tillit4. Interoperabilitet: Kan operere på tvers av ulikt utstyr og
programvarer5. Hele tiden under utvikling 6. Desentralisering7. Stadig bedre (’kulere’ multimedia)
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
WWW- arkitekturen (her)
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
Litt om WWW-standarder
HTTP v. 1.1 (RFC 2616 ):
• Sikre at HTML-dokumenter kan utveksles på tvers av utstyrstyper og tekniske plattformer – F eks håndtere cookies, P3P,..
HTML 4.01 (W3C – anbefaling):• Sikre at HTML-dokumenter har samme utseende for
ulike nettlesere, – Reetablere skille mellom innhold og presentasjon – Støtte for ulike mediatyper – Økt tilgjengelig– …….
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
Hvordan gjøre WWW tilgjengelig for alle
Universell tilgjengelighet : • Web Accessibility Initiative (WAI)
– For alle brukere uansett funksjonshemning mm
– På alle typer teknisk plattform– På alle typer utstyr
DRI1002-V04 Fforelesning uke 17,19 Arild Jansen , AFIN
’Funksjonshemning er ikke en sykdom, men en del av livet !
• Fargeblind butikk-kunde• Elev med dysleksi• Blind arbeidstaker • Pensjonist som bankkunde• Journalist med mysesyke• Døv student • Bruker med gammelt utstyr og
programvarer • …..• ……..
top related